How to Get Cursed Egg in Grow a Chicken Fighter

The Cursed Egg is the only normal egg that can hatch the 404 Chick, so the whole route is about getting a chicken that lays it on repeat. Here is who lays it, what is inside, and the shortest chain from a fresh save.

Quick answer: how to get a Cursed Egg

  • Hatch Scratch Eggs until you pull an NPC Chick (12% of the Scratch pool). About 80% of the eggs it lays are Cursed Eggs.
  • Open that first Cursed Egg. The two most common results, NPC Chick (20%) and Stone Face (19%), both lay Cursed Eggs, and Stone Face lays them 100% of the time.
  • Once you hold a Stone Face, you have a self-feeding loop: every Cursed Egg you open has roughly a 1-in-5 chance of being another 100% layer.

There is no Cursed Egg in the code list and no shop price we could verify, so laying chickens are the only route. See the codes page for the eggs that codes do give.

Who lays it

ChickenCursed Egg lay rateNotes
NPC Chick80%Remaining 20% are Scratch Eggs. Comes from Scratch Egg (12%) or Cursed Egg (20%)
Stone Face100%Footage shows one egg about every 2 minutes; one player reports the rebirth buff cuts that to about 1 minute
404 Chick100%The Secret itself lays Cursed Eggs, so a 404 keeps the loop going
Stonks Hen100%Listed by two indexes
Bonk Hen, Karaoke Rooster, Sigma Rooster, This is Fine, Deep-Fried Hen, Imposter Chick100%Reported by one roster; every Cursed-only chicken appears to lay Cursed back

Stone Face is the grind chicken. Put it in the coop (or the Incubator once you unlock it) and keep collecting.

Hatch pool

These odds are the community in-game index snapshot. Rarities below are the chickens’ own tags; the game does not put a rarity on the egg itself.

ChickenRarityOdds
NPC ChickCommon20%
Stone FaceCommon19%
Bonk HenUncommon15%
Stonks HenUncommon15%
Karaoke RoosterRare9%
Sigma RoosterRare9%
This is FineEpic6%
Deep-Fried HenLegendary4%
Imposter ChickMythic2%
404 ChickSecretunder 1%

That under-1% line is the reason anyone farms this egg. One recorded run opened a batch of Cursed Eggs and pulled several Secrets in a row, which says more about volume than luck: the more 100% layers you run, the more rolls you get.

What to hatch it for

404 Chick is the target. It is a Secret, it has the fastest base speed in the game according to multiple players, and it is one half of the 404 + Cycle of Ash combo that top lists call S tier. Secrets and Cosmics are also the only chickens that reach the 31 stat cap. Full breakdown on the 404 Chick page.

Everything else in the pool is filler or a better layer. Imposter Chick (Mythic) and Deep-Fried Hen (Legendary) are decent sell or fusion fodder, and the fact that Cursed-only chickens lay Cursed back means none of your hatches are wasted.

If you would rather gamble, the Blazing Egg lists 404 Chick at 8%, but Blazing Eggs only come from winning the Hot Egg event.

Fastest farm route

  1. Start: Classic Rooster lays Nest Eggs. Hatch for Cosmo Brat (10%).
  2. Cosmo Brat lays Scratch Eggs 100% of the time (one index times it at about 2 min 40 s per egg). The SERGIOVERSE code also hands you one Scratch Egg.
  3. Hatch Scratch Eggs for NPC Chick (12%).
  4. NPC Chick lays Cursed Eggs 80% of the time. Open them.
  5. Hatch a Stone Face (19%) and keep it laying. Open every Cursed Egg until the 404 Chick shows up.
  6. When you get a 404, it lays Cursed 100%, and you can fuse it with a Radiant Fenghuang from the Royal Egg line to lock Cycle of Ash (see the fusion guide).

Rebirth speeds the whole thing up because the rebirth buff shortens lay timers, so do not delay your first rebirth to farm.

Common questions

Is the Cursed Egg rare or epic? Fan sites disagree; the game rates chickens, not eggs. Treat it as a mid-game egg you reach a few minutes after your first Scratch Egg.

Can I skip NPC Chick? Not really. NPC Chick is the only bridge from the Scratch line into the Cursed line. Once you own any Cursed-only chicken you no longer need it.

Does the 404 Chick lay anything besides Cursed Eggs? Two indexes list 100% Cursed, so a 404 is also your best long-term Cursed layer.
